Output 9a858fa235772796da0e407e5f9a5afdb9785af913b44437bd56229f5fc047c9:1

value
511693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b9da773753c81c2d39c022d2796f5e53b6a5521 OP_EQUAL
address
3Jo39R3RJ8aBceAWq9PxSnMgGefNSDJUc3
transaction
9a858fa235772796da0e407e5f9a5afdb9785af913b44437bd56229f5fc047c9
spent
true